Asymptotic Density in a Coalescing Random Walk Model
We consider a system of particles, each of which performs a continuous time random walk on Z. The particles interact only at times when a particle jumps to a site at which there are a number of other particles present. متن کاملDependent double branching annihilating random walk
Double (or parity conserving) branching annihilating random walk, introduced in [19], is a one-dimensional non-attractive particle system in which positive and negative particles perform nearest neighbor hopping, produce two offsprings to neighboring lattice points and annihilate when they meet. متن کاملSurvival and Extinction of Caring Double-branching Annihilating Random Walk
Branching annihilating random walk (BARW) is a generic term for a class of interacting particle systems on Z in which, as time evolves, particles execute random walks, produce offspring (on neighbouring sites) and (instantaneously) disappear when they meet other particles.
